A friend tipped me off to a large number of GIS jobs listed with CareerBuilder in and around Colorado’s Front Range. A search on GIS for Denver yields 37 job listings from Boulder, Denver, Aurora, Broomfield, Thornton and Westminster. A lot of these job descriptions are similar, and most indicate that the company is confidential. [...]
